Can WVU Land 'Package Deal' of DMV Linemen? Decision Around the Corner

In this story:
West Virginia currently has just one offensive lineman committed in the 2024 recruiting class (Kyle Altuner) but they're hoping that changes in the coming weeks as Moritz Schmoranzer (Roanoke, VA) and Ryan Howerton (Laurel, MD) are nearing their decisions.
Schmoranzer announced Saturday night that he will be revealing his college decision on June 30th at 6:30 p.m., choosing from Miami, Pitt, Virginia Tech, and West Virginia.

Howerton, a fellow DMV recruit and top WVU target, saw the tweet and said that the two need to be a "package deal."

Howerton is considering three of the same four schools - Pitt, Virginia Tech, and West Virginia.
"It was great, man. The visit was awesome," Schmoranzer said of his official visit to WVU earlier this month. "It was my first time up there and I had little to no knowledge but I definitely learned a load. What stuck out the most was the bond the players have with each other and the coaches. Plus, the amount and level of recovery they have are things most schools don't have."
